The main reason quests suck in eq is that they don't track your quests. If you ever played DAoC you will know how quests should be done.  Before you can complete any quest you first need to get it. Then after you have got it and kill the mob that it says to kill you AND everyone in your party who also has the quest will automatically have the item in your invetory. Also the mobs you have to kill are not stupid long days/week long spawns they are pretty much always there. Also theres no point killing the mob before you have the quest as it won't drop the items needed. Nor are they camped because they don't drop loot.

Also the quest log which shows you the quests you are doing has decent directions on what you need to do. All in all its a pretty good quest system.
